y = 2x-3 
x + y = 18 
Since you already know what y is equal to, we can plug that in into the second equation. 
x + (2x-3) = 18 
x + 2x -3 = 18 
3x -3 = 18
Add 3 to both sides of the equation. (By doing this, we can isolate the 3x on the left side by getting rid of the -3) 
3x = 21 
Divide 3 on both sides 
x = 7
